Test buyer problems as separate hypotheses.

For med spas, the first hypotheses should include: Botox, filler, laser, and body treatments each need different education and trust framing. Before-after-heavy creative can create compliance and platform review risk. The best angles often answer fear of looking overdone, not price. Each needs its own lane so the account can show what deserves budget.

Test first-three-second hooks, not just finished concepts.

The same offer can win or lose based on the opening. Examples worth testing include The nobody will know but you hook, The first appointment anxiety hook, The holiday glow timeline hook, The membership maintenance hook.

Match creative drops to market timing.

Med spa demand is shaped by wedding season, summer body confidence, holiday parties, new year refresh. Creative testing works better when those triggers become test lanes before demand peaks.

Read results through unit economics.

$300 treatment → $2,000-$8,000 annual aesthetic client value. That means the best creative test is not the prettiest ad — it is the angle that creates profitable booked opportunities.

Keep every test within compliance boundaries.

Avoid medical outcome guarantees, unsafe before-after usage, unrealistic beauty claims, or unapproved treatment claims.
